Inconsistency in the work of methods requiring the "account" argument
I recognize the inconsistency in the work of methods with account argument. Most of the methods allow putting any type as the account name.
However few methods : find_recurent_transfer, get_collateralized_conversion_requests, get_conversion_requests
checking is account exist and if not exist throw exception. I think whole methods should work in the same way.

Example:
SEND: '{"jsonrpc":"2.0", "method":"database_api.find_recurrent_transfers", "params":{"from":"non-exist-acc"}, "id":1}'
RECEIVE: "message" : "Assert Exception:from_account != nullptr: Given 'from' account does not exist."
